本文将详细介绍集合的基本运算差集,并提供了差集的定义、性质、示例及一些实际应用。 一、差集的定义 给定两个集合A和B,它们的差集(denoted as A\B)定义为包含所有属于A但不属于B的元素的集合。即,差集是A与B的交集的补集。 二、差集的性质 1. A\B ≠ B\A,差集不满足交换律。因为两个集合的差集结果取决...
集合类型的 difference() 方法可以返回两个或多个集合的差集: set1.difference(s2, s3, ...) 例如,以下示例使用 difference() 方法查找集合 s1 和 s2 的差集: s1 = {'Python', 'Java', 'C++'} s2 = {'C#', 'Java', 'C++'} s = s1.difference(s2) print(s) 输出结果如下: {'Python'} 下...
在这个示例中,我们使用`union()`方法获取集合set1和set2的并集,并将结果赋值给union_set。最后,我们打印并集的结果。差集运算 差集运算用于获取在一个集合中但不在另一个集合中的元素,使用的是`difference()`方法或`-`操作符。下面是一个实例:set1 = {1, 2, 3, 4, 5}set2 = {4, 5, 6, 7}di...
以下是集合的基本运算,包括交集、并集、差集和补集。 1. 交集(Intersection) 交集运算返回两个集合中共同存在的元素。在Python中,可以使用 `&` 运算符或 `intersection()` 方法来实现。例如: ```python A = {1, 2, 3} B = {3, 4, 5} intersection = A & B # 或者 A.intersection(B) ``` 结果...
集合论作为数学的一个分支,其核心概念如并集、交集、差集和子集等,在数据组织、算法设计、数据库查询优化等领域发挥着重要作用。本文将逐一解析这些概念,并通过实例和图表加深理解。 1. 并集(Union) 定义:两个集合A和B的并集,记作A ∪ B,是由所有属于A或属于B(或两者都属于)的元素所组成的集合。 实例:设A ...
在集合论中,"差集"和"补集"是两个重要的概念。本文将详细介绍集合的差集和补集,并探讨它们的应用。 一、集合的差集 差集是指从一个集合中减去另一个集合的操作。如果有两个集合A和B,A减去B得到的差集记作A-B,表示A中所有不属于B的元素组成的集合。 举个例子,假设有两个集合A={1, 2, 3, 4}和B={3...
差集的运算法则有以下几点: 1.定义:差集是在一个集合中剔除另一个集合中包含的元素后所得到的结果。 2.记号:差集用符号“-”表示,即A-B表示集合A与集合B的差集。 3.元素的顺序没有影响:A-B与B-A的结果不同,因为要根据差集的定义,先确定哪个集合中的元素要被剔除。但是,对于同一个集合,元素的顺序不影响...
相对差集{1,2,3},{2,3}是{1},而相对差集{2,3},{是{4}。当集合a是集合u的子集时,相对差集ua也被称为集合u中集合a的补集。如果我们研究维恩图,当集合u是一个完备集,并且可以通过上下文找到完备集的定义时,我们将用a代替集合ua。学习数学需要坚持和不断练习,以下是一些学习数学的...
2.4、集合的对称差集运算方法 2.4.1、使用“^”运算符进行对称差集运算 2.4.2、使用symmetric_difference()方法进行对称差集运算 欢迎你来到站长在线的站长学堂学习Python知识,本文学习的是《Python中集合的交集、并集、差集和对称差集运算方法详解》。主要讲的是集合运算的相关的概念,及运算方法,包括:集合的交集、集...
交集是取两集合公共的元素,通过图1,我们可以知道,set1和set2的公共元素为3。即交集:{3} 差集:{1,2}或{4,5} 差集是取一个集合中另一集合没有的元素。如果set1差set2(set1-set2),那就是图中的①部分,那如果set2差set1(set2-set1)那就是图中的③部分。对称差集:{1,2,4,5} 对称差集...